Lamotrigine for acute and chronic pain

Lamotrigine is not recommended for neuropathic pain due to limited evidence of effectiveness. This review found no significant benefits, with a notable risk of skin rash, suggesting other treatments are more suitable.
Area of Science:
- Neurology
- Pain Management
- Pharmacology
Background:
- Anticonvulsant medications are utilized for neuropathic pain management.
- This review evaluates lamotrigine's efficacy in pain relief.
Purpose of the Study:
- To assess the analgesic efficacy and adverse effects of lamotrigine for acute and chronic pain.
- To determine if lamotrigine is a viable treatment option for various pain conditions.
Main Methods:
- Systematic review of Randomized Controlled Trials (RCTs) identified through MEDLINE, EMBASE, and Cochrane Library.
- Included studies involved adults (18+) with acute or chronic pain, assessing pain intensity using validated scales.
- Meta-analysis was performed using fixed or random effects models based on statistical heterogeneity; Number-Needed-to-Treat (NNT) and Number-Needed-to-Harm (NNH) were calculated.
Main Results:
- Seven RCTs involving 502 participants with neuropathic pain were included; no studies on acute pain were found.
- Conditions studied included central post-stroke pain, diabetic neuropathy, HIV-related neuropathy, and trigeminal neuralgia.
- A statistically significant result was observed in one subgroup for HIV-related neuropathy, but it was deemed unlikely to be clinically significant (NNT 4.3). Approximately 7% of participants reported skin rash.
Conclusions:
- Lamotrigine is unlikely to be beneficial for treating neuropathic pain based on current limited evidence.
- More effective treatments, including other anticonvulsants and antidepressants, are available.
- Lamotrigine does not currently hold a significant therapeutic role for neuropathic pain management.
